A key facet of using domains for digital identity verification is the SSL certificate, represented by the ‘https’ protocol and often accompanied by a padlock symbol in the browser’s address bar. SSL certificates not only encrypt data transferred between a user and a website, ensuring privacy, but they also validate the website’s ownership. When a user sees the padlock symbol, it serves as an indicator that the domain is legitimate and has been authenticated by a trusted third-party entity, commonly known as a Certificate Authority (CA).

Beyond SSL, the very nature of domain registration plays a role in identity verification. Top-level domains (TLDs) that have stringent registration requirements, such as certain country-specific domains or specialized TLDs like .bank, offer an added layer of authentication. Websites operating on these domains undergo rigorous checks before they can register their domain, assuring users of their legitimacy.

Moreover, the reputation of a domain itself can serve as a mechanism for identity verification. Long-standing domains, with histories of genuine content and verified ownership, inherently convey trust. Tools and services that provide domain reputation scores, based on factors like domain age, historical data, and user feedback, can assist users in verifying the authenticity of digital entities.
